Course Content

• Xhosa Phonetics and Phonology: An Introduction
• Consonant Systems in Xhosa: Places and Manners of Articulation
• Vowel Systems in Xhosa: Length, Height, and Backness
• Tone in Xhosa: High and Low Tones and their Interaction
• Xhosa Phonotactics: Syllable Structure and Constraints
• Stress and Rhythm in Xhosa
• Click Consonants in Xhosa: Production and Distribution
• Xhosa Morphology and its Phonological Effects
• Phonological Processes in Xhosa: Assimilation, Deletion, and Insertion
• Analyzing Xhosa Phonological Data: Transcription and Analysis Techniques
